Five Pro Tricks They Don't Tell You in the Manual

1. The "Peak Shaving" Power Play

Utility companies aren't exactly your buddies when it comes to pricing. Here's how to game the system:

  • Program your module to discharge during peak hours (usually 4-9PM)
  • Set recharge cycles for off-peak times
  • Use weather integration – modules hate surprises as much as you do

Walmart's 1.5MWh storage system saves them $200,000 annually through peak shaving. Your home savings won't be that dramatic, but 30-50% reductions are common.

The Maintenance Myth Busted

"Set it and forget it" works for rotisserie chickens, not energy storage. Here's your cheat sheet:

Task Frequency Cost If Ignored
Terminal cleaning 6 months $150 service fee
Software updates Monthly 15% efficiency loss

Fun fact: Lithium-ion modules actually prefer being partially discharged rather than kept fully charged. Who knew batteries had such complicated feelings?

Utility Company Negotiation 101

Did you know many utilities offer rebates for grid-supportive modules? California's SGIP program has doled out $1.2 billion in storage incentives. Arm yourself with:

  • Your module's UL certification
  • Cycling frequency reports
  • That sweet, sweet kWh data
